Ok, I've found how to work around my problem below.
The flag -nativepath needs to be passed to the jtreg:
-nativepath:/var/tmp/sspitsyn/jdk9/build/linux-x86_64-normal-server-fastdebug/images/test/hotspot/jtreg/native

Hi,
Could you, please, review these test-only changes
(adding a new test).
CR:https://bugs.openjdk.java.net/browse/JDK-8153978
"New test to verify the modules info as returned by the JVMTI"
Webrev:http://cr.openjdk.java.net/~akulyakh/8153978_01/
<http://cr.openjdk.java.net/%7Eakulyakh/8153978_01/>
The new test verifies that JVMTI returns the
correct info about the modules loaded at the application startup.
It also verifies that the returned info is
consistent with the same info returned by the Java API.
It then loads a new named module and checks the
correctness of the JVMTI info again.
Due to a tools
issuehttps://bugs.openjdk.java.net/browse/CODETOOLS-7901662 the test can only
be pushed in when the updated jtreg is released.
The test passes fine with the nightly jtreg build,
containing the CODETOOLS-7901662 fix.
